다음을 통해 공유


UpgradePolicy 클래스

자동, 수동 또는 롤링 업그레이드 정책에 대해 설명합니다.

상속
azure.mgmt.compute._serialization.Model
UpgradePolicy

생성자

UpgradePolicy(*, mode: str | _models.UpgradeMode | None = None, rolling_upgrade_policy: _models.RollingUpgradePolicy | None = None, automatic_os_upgrade: bool | None = None, auto_os_upgrade_policy: _models.AutoOSUpgradePolicy | None = None, **kwargs: Any)

키워드 전용 매개 변수

Name Description
mode
str 또는 UpgradeMode

확장 집합에서 가상 머신으로 업그레이드하는 모드를 지정합니다.:code:
<br />가능한 값은 수동<br />``<br /> - 확장 집합의 가상 머신에 대한 업데이트 애플리케이션을 제어합니다. manualUpgrade 작업을 사용하여 이 작업을 수행합니다.:code:
<br />자동 - 확장 집합의 모든 가상 머신이 동시에 자동으로 업데이트됩니다. 알려진 값은 "자동", "수동" 및 "롤링"입니다.

rolling_upgrade_policy

롤링 업그레이드를 수행하는 동안 사용되는 구성 매개 변수입니다.

automatic_os_upgrade

최신 버전의 이미지를 사용할 수 있게 될 때 OS 업그레이드를 롤링 방식으로 확장 집합 인스턴스에 자동으로 적용해야 하는지 여부입니다.

auto_os_upgrade_policy

자동 OS 업그레이드를 수행하는 데 사용되는 구성 매개 변수입니다.

변수

Name Description
mode
str 또는 UpgradeMode

확장 집합에서 가상 머신으로 업그레이드하는 모드를 지정합니다.:code:
<br />가능한 값은 수동<br />``<br /> - 확장 집합의 가상 머신에 대한 업데이트 애플리케이션을 제어합니다. manualUpgrade 작업을 사용하여 이 작업을 수행합니다.:code:
<br />자동 - 확장 집합의 모든 가상 머신이 동시에 자동으로 업데이트됩니다. 알려진 값은 "자동", "수동" 및 "롤링"입니다.

rolling_upgrade_policy

롤링 업그레이드를 수행하는 동안 사용되는 구성 매개 변수입니다.

automatic_os_upgrade

최신 버전의 이미지를 사용할 수 있게 될 때 OS 업그레이드를 롤링 방식으로 확장 집합 인스턴스에 자동으로 적용해야 하는지 여부입니다.

auto_os_upgrade_policy

자동 OS 업그레이드를 수행하는 데 사용되는 구성 매개 변수입니다.